In today's digital landscape, websites act as critical points of operation for businesses of all sizes. They serve as the primary platforms for transactions, interactions, and content sharing. As the number of online businesses continues to grow, so does the importance of securing these platforms. A cyberattack or a data breach could result in significant loss of user trust, compromise sensitive information, and impact a business's standing. Hence, it is vital to understand and implement solid website security measures.
This detailed guide is designed to provide you with the necessary knowledge and resources to enhance your website security effectively. Irrespective of your business's size or the scale of your online operations, this blog post will serve as a pivotal resource. Let's delve into the crucial aspects of website security for a safer and more secure online experience.
Understanding Website Security
To defend against threats, it's essential to first know what you're up against. Website security encompasses measures to protect websites from cyberattacks and unauthorized access. Without adequate security, websites are vulnerable to a host of threats, including malware, phishing attacks, DDoS (Distributed Denial of Service) attacks, and data breaches, among others. These security incidents can result in serious consequences: compromised customer information, theft of intellectual property, financial loss, and a damaged reputation, not to mention the dire legal repercussions that can arise from failing to protect user data. Understanding these risks is the first step toward mitigating potential threats.
Essential Security Measures
Strong Passwords and Authentication
User access control is a frontline defense for website security. Strong, unique passwords coupled with layers of authentication (like two-factor authentication, biometrics, etc.) are fundamental. It’s advisable to use password managers and to encourage complex, unpredictable passwords amongst all users, especially those with administrative privileges.
Regular Software Updates and Patches
Cybercriminals exploit vulnerabilities in outdated software. CMS platforms, plugins, and server operating systems must be regularly updated with the latest security patches and versions. Consider automating updates where possible to ensure timely upgrades.
Secure Hosting and SSL Certificates
Choosing the right hosting provider is another critical decision for website security. Opt for hosts that offer robust security features, like attack monitoring and prevention, and use Secure Socket Layer (SSL) certificates. SSL ensures encrypted connections, safeguarding data as it’s transferred between users and the website - this is non-negotiable for e-commerce sites and any platform that handles personal data.
Web Application Firewalls
A Web Application Firewall (WAF) offers another layer of protection, monitoring, and filtering incoming traffic to block malicious requests. It acts as a gatekeeper against various online threats and is a valuable tool in any comprehensive security strategy.
Intrusion Detection Systems (IDS)
An Intrusion Detection System (IDS) monitors network traffic for suspicious activity and issues alerts when it detects potential threats. By identifying malicious behavior early, an IDS allows you to thwart attacks before they can cause significant damage.
User Training and Awareness
While technology plays a significant role in website security, the human factor cannot be overlooked. Users, particularly those with administrative access, should be trained on best practices and common threats like phishing attempts. Regularly updating users about the importance of their role in maintaining website security can create a more robust defense against cyber attacks.
Protecting User Data
Encryption and Secure Data Storage
Data encryption is critical, at rest and in transit. If your website collects any form of user data, from email addresses to payment details, ensure that it's encrypted with strong algorithms. Furthermore, server-side encryption is essential for protecting data after it has reached your infrastructure.
Privacy Policies and Compliance
Beyond technical measures, comply with data protection regulations such as GDPR or CCPA, depending on your geographical operations or user base location. Learn about the impending GDPR 2.0 coming in 2024. Transparent privacy policies not only comply with legal standards but also build trust with your audience.
User Authentication and Access Control
Implementing multi-factor authentication adds an extra layer of protection for user accounts, especially when dealing with sensitive data. It might involve a password plus a secondary verification, like a unique code sent to a mobile device. Access control, on the other hand, ensures that only authorized individuals can access specific data. It's a critical measure for businesses that handle customer data, as it minimizes the risk of internal data breaches.
Regular Audits and Updates
Performing regular data audits can help you spot any inconsistencies or irregularities in how data is stored, processed, and managed. Any issues found should be addressed promptly to avoid potential data breaches. Additionally, ensuring that all your systems, software, and applications are updated regularly is necessary to protect against vulnerabilities that could be exploited by cybercriminals.
Website Backup and Recovery
Regular backups ensure that, in the event of data loss, you can restore your website to a previous state without significant downtime or data integrity issues. Backups should be automated, secure, and frequent, with stored backup files encrypted and kept separate from your primary data.
Furthermore, disaster recovery plans are imperative as a website owner. Have a clear, tested disaster recovery plan for various scenarios, whether a hacking incident, natural disaster, or an inadvertent internal error. Time is of the essence when a security incident occurs, and a solidified process plan can minimize impact and recovery time.
Conclusion
Maintaining a secure website is an ongoing endeavor that adapts in response to evolving threats. The key points to remember are practicing good password hygiene, staying updated with software patches, selecting secure and reputable hosting services, encrypting user data, conducting regular backups, and committing to continuous education on security matters.
By implementing the security measures outlined in this guide, you are not just protecting your online presence, but also reinforcing the trust your users place in your digital ecosystem. With cyber threats becoming more sophisticated, website owners must take a proactive stance on website security.
Begin today by auditing your current security posture and identifying which areas require strengthening. Remember, the cost of prevention is always lower than the cost of a breach. Prioritize your website's security and ensure that the digital expression of your brand remains a safe, trusted environment for all.
Comments